    Man charged after fiberoptic internet lines damaged in Preston County

    By Alexandra Weaver,

    2024-09-01

    BRANDONVILLE, W.Va. (WBOY) — A City of Kingwood police officer in training at the West Virginia State Police Academy has been charged after Preston County deputies say he fired multiple shots in Brandonville, damaging Prodigi’s fiberoptic internet lines on Saturday.

    The damage is estimated to be more than $2,500, the Preston County Sheriff’s Office said in a press release.

    https://img.particlenews.com/image.php?url=1BrMGk_0vH1ECM700
    Chase Waugh

    Chase Waugh, 21, was arrested and charged with felony destruction of property, the release said.
